What is Geo Tracking?

Geo Tracking uses the native location services built into Windows, macOS and Linux operating systems to determine a device’s physical location. During device scan, this data is automatically collected and visualized on an interactive Device Locations Map, providing an at-a-glance overview of where your IT assets are.

Device Locations Map

The central feature is a real-time global map accessible via Inventory → Device Locations. This map provides an at-a-glance overview of your entire fleet of managed endpoints.

  • Quick Identification: Hover over a marker to see a device's name.
  • Detailed Information: Clicking a marker reveals the device name, logged-in user, address, IP address, and last contact time.
  • Location History: If enabled, you can access a device's historical location data directly from the map.

Device-Specific Location Details

For a more granular look, visit the Location tab under a specific device's details. This view provides precise location information, including the address and coordinates, which are essential for endpoint security monitoring and recovery efforts.

Geo Location Settings

You can customize Geo Tracking to fit your organization's needs by going to Inventory → Settings → Geo Location.

  • Enable/Disable: Turn the feature on or off.
  • Targeting: Apply tracking to All Devices, Selected Groups, or All Except Selected Groups.
  • Location History: Optionally enable historical data retention with options for 7, 15, 30, 60, or 90 days. This is a crucial feature for compliance and auditing.
Zecurit does not store any historical location data unless Location History is explicitly enabled.

How It Works and Requirements

Zecurit's Geo Tracking leverages the native location services of a device's operating system. For the feature to work, these services must be enabled.

  • Windows: In Settings → Privacy → Location, ensure "Location for this device" and "Allow apps to access your location" are both on.
  • macOS: In System Settings → Privacy & Security → Location Services, enable "Location Services" and ensure the Zecurit Agent has access.

FAQ

  • How does geo location tracking work in Zecurit Asset Manager?

    Zecurit Asset Manager uses the operating system’s built-in location services (such as those in Windows, macOS and Linux OS) to determine a device’s physical location. Once enabled, the Zecurit Agent fetches real-time location data and displays it on an interactive map, allowing IT administrators to track and manage devices by location.

  • Is historical location data stored automatically?

    No. Zecurit does not store location history by default. Historical geo tracking data is only stored if the Location History setting is explicitly enabled in the Geo Location settings. Administrators can choose how long this data is retained—7, 15, 30, 60, or 90 days.

  • Can I track only specific groups of devices?

    Yes. You can configure geo location tracking to apply to: - All devices - Only selected groups - All except selected groups This flexibility ensures that you can enforce location tracking policies based on business needs, compliance requirements, or organizational structure.
